19-05-2016 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ned Addl. Public Prosecutor.
The petitioner, who was mother-in-law of deceased, has prayed for grant of anticipatory bail in Bochahan P.S. Case No. 273 of 2014 registered for the offence under Sections 304(B)/34 of the Indian Penal Code.
After hearing learned counsel for the parties and considering the material on record, I do not find any ground to extend the privilege of anticipatory bail.
Dismissed.
It goes without saying that if the petitioner within a period of six weeks from today surrenders before the court below and makes a prayer for regular bail, the learned court below,
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.19608 of 2016 (2) dt.19-05-2016 2/2 without being prejudiced with this order, may examine the same and pass appropriate order preferably on the same date in accordance with law.
